Holiday Homes in Goa: How to Earn Rental Income in 2026

Holiday homes in Goa generating rental income with villa and apartment investment opportunities

Goa is one of India’s strongest holiday home markets. With year-round tourism, luxury lifestyle demand, and the rise of Airbnb-style rentals, many investors are buying holiday homes to generate rental income.

But the big question is Can you really earn consistent rental income from a holiday home in Goa? The answer is yes  if you choose the right location, property type, and management strategy.

 

Why Holiday Homes in Goa Are in High Demand

Goa is not just a seasonal market anymore. Demand now comes from:

  • Domestic tourists
    • International tourists
    • Digital nomads
    • Work-from-home professionals
    • Weekend travelers from Mumbai and Bangalore
    • Destination wedding guests

This steady demand creates strong short-term rental potential.

 

Best Locations for Holiday Home Investment

North Goa – High Rental Returns

Most profitable for short-term rentals:

  • Candolim
    • Calangute
    • Baga
    • Anjuna
    • Vagator
    • Assagao

 

Why?

  • Heavy tourist footfall
    • Nightlife and beaches
    • Luxury villa demand
    • Higher nightly rental rates

 

South Goa – Premium & Peaceful

Best for luxury and long stays:

  • Colva
    • Benaulim
    • Varca
    • Cavelossim

 

Why?

  • Calm environment
    • Resort-style living
    • Higher-end buyers
    • Stable long-term rentals

Rental Income Potential in 2026

Apartments (1BHK / 2BHK)

Off-season: ₹2,000 – ₹4,000 per night
Peak season: ₹4,000 – ₹7,000 per night

Estimated annual yield: 5–9%

 

Luxury Villas

Off-season: ₹15,000 – ₹25,000 per night
Peak season: ₹30,000 – ₹80,000 per night

Estimated annual yield: 8–12% (if well managed)

 

Income depends on:

  • Location
    • Property quality
    • Amenities (pool, view, parking)
    • Online rating and reviews
    • Management efficiency

 

What Type of Property Works Best?

1 – ated Community Apartments

  • Easier to manage
    • Lower maintenance cost
    • Good for mid-budget investors

 

2 – Private Pool Villas

  • High rental demand
    • Premium pricing
    • Better resale value
    • Higher maintenance cost

 

3 – Boutique Luxury Homes

  • Target premium segment
    • Lower competition
    • Strong appreciation

 

Legal Considerations Before Renting

Before listing on Airbnb or similar platforms:

  • Check zoning regulations
    • Verify local panchayat rules
    • Ensure society allows short-term rentals
    • Confirm RERA registration (if new project)
    • Maintain rental agreements

Always ensure compliance to avoid penalties.

 

Expenses You Must Calculate

Many investors calculate income but ignore expenses.

Key costs include:

  • Maintenance charges
    • Electricity and water bills
    • Property management fees (15–25%)
    • Cleaning and housekeeping
    • Property tax
    • Platform commission
    • Repair and furnishing costs

Net income depends on proper cost planning.

 

Property Management Options

Self-Management

  • Higher profit margin
    • Requires local presence
    • Time-consuming

 

Professional Property Managers

  • Handle bookings, cleaning, guests
    • Charge commission
    • Useful for NRIs and outstation owners

For serious investors, professional management improves occupancy rates.

 

Risks to Consider

  • Seasonal income fluctuations
    • Regulatory changes
    • Overpricing property at purchase
    • Poor property maintenance
    • Increasing competition

Buying at the right price is crucial for strong ROI.
